The Director, Engineering is a senior leadership role responsible for setting the strategic direction, capability, and performance of the Engineering function within Beauty Tools. This role leads and develops a team of Project Engineers (and potentially engineering leaders), ensuring consistent, high-quality execution across a portfolio of product development programs aligned to business objectives. The Director serves as a key member of the cross-functional leadership team, partnering with Program Management, Quality, Innovation, and Advanced Technology to drive product roadmap delivery, strengthen organizational capability, and enable scalable, best-in-class engineering practices. This role is accountable for engineering strategy, resource planning aligned to multi-year product roadmaps, and establishing technical excellence across the full product lifecycle. While not directly managing individual programs, the Director ensures engineering readiness, organizational alignment, and execution excellence across all initiatives.
